Well I went out hunting again today. It was very still in the woods today.
Was making my though the woods, & stopped for awhile against a tree, to see if I could spot any squirrels.

Then  I hear a squirrel barking at me. But where is he, I can’t see him because for all the leaves on the trees! So I slowly move to the sound of him barking.

Still no squirrel, make my way to a tree, for a rest for the gun.
Then all of a sudden I hear him again, he's real close. There he is!!

He is mad has hell, & barking even more now at me. Then I see him!
He is running down the tree head first. He stops in plain sight, in the open.

He raise the 9mm Daq outlaw to my shoulder, pull the trigger!

Down he comes dead as a door nail, at 30 yards. I hit him in the head with a 64gr. lead ball. Hunting with a air gun, is a lot of fun! You have to get in closer for your shots, & stalk more.




Using a air gun gives the hunter, a better hunt!
